Extended Day

Students who have been absent from tests or have accumulated multiple zeros

and are endanger of failing the six weeks will be assigned extended day on Mon-

days and Wednesdays from 3:30-4:30 to make up missed tests or assignments.

As the six weeks ends, please look at your student's grades in parent portal. Any zeroes are assignments that need

to be turned in but will be late. Assignments may be corrected for 1/2 credit up to a 75. Tests and Quizzes may be

retaken (after reteaching and review) to be averaged with their original test up to a 75. These tests will need to be

taken by Wednesday.
